The cost of dry cleaning can vary depending on a few factors, such as the type of item being cleaned, the fabric, and the location of the dry cleaner. Generally, dry cleaning prices range from $5 to $20 per item, but prices may be higher for certain types of items.
For example, suits and dresses are typically more expensive to dry clean than shirts and pants. The cost of dry cleaning a suit may range from $15 to $35, while the cost of dry cleaning a dress may range from $10 to $30. Similarly, specialty items such as wedding gowns and leather jackets may be more expensive to dry clean due to the special care required to clean these items.
Dry cleaning prices may also vary based on the fabric of the item. Delicate fabrics such as silk and cashmere may require special care and attention, which can increase the cost of dry cleaning. Additionally, items with heavy stains or odors may require additional treatment, which can also increase the cost of dry cleaning.
The location of the dry cleaner can also affect the cost of dry cleaning services. Dry cleaners located in urban areas or upscale neighborhoods may charge higher prices than those located in more rural or suburban areas.
